Restaurant Summary

The room feels warm and bustling with the glow of the smoker and a bar lined with bourbons. Servers often guide guests through whiskey pairings and dish explanations, and one diner noted, "our waiter made the pairing feel like a tour." However, there are moments of service rigidity and pacing delays during peak times, so expectations should be set accordingly. The cooking blends Texas barbecue with Mediterranean cues and modern technique: brisket with pepper gravy, wagyu tartare in cannoli, and foie gras soup. Plates are polished and generous, leaning more chef-driven than rustic. It suits diners who enjoy creative, smoke-kissed flavors, cocktails, and a tasting-menu arc over classic pile-high BBQ. Families should know the focus is on tasting menus and inventive flavors. There are some a la carte options like brisket, spare ribs, and gnocchi that kids may accept, but no clear kids menu and portions/pacing can run long. For picky eaters, consider the simpler a la carte items and avoid peak hours.
